Devon Ke Dev... Mahadev , which aired on Life OK from 2011 to 2014, is widely considered one of the most successful and critically acclaimed mythological shows in Indian television history. The series redefined the portrayal of Shiva, moving away from conventional depictions to highlight the philosophical and human-like aspects of the deity. After their union, the narrative focuses on Shiva and Parvati's life on Mount Kailash. In a famous and emotionally charged sequence, Shiva beheads his own son, Ganesha, before resurrecting him with the head of an elephant. The story also covers the dramatic birth of Kartikeya, their elder son, born from a powerful energy to slay the demon Tarakasur. Parvati struggles with her duties as a mother, often feeling neglected by Shiva, which becomes a recurring theme in their marital life.
